Nov 19, 2022 · The uncompleted execution of Kenneth Eugene Smith was the state's third since 2018 Smith was sentenced to death in 1988 for the murder-for-hire slaying of a preacher's wife Kenneth Eugene Smith, an Alabama man convicted in a murder-for-hire plot of a pastor’s wife, is set to be executed on Thursday. Smith was one of two men who were each paid $1,000 to kill Elizabeth Sennett on behalf of her husband, Rev. Charles Sennett, who was in debt and wanted to collect on insurance. The US Supreme Court and a federal appeals ...The execution of Kenneth Eugene Smith (July 4, 1965 – January 25, 2024) took place in the U.S. state of Alabama by means of nitrogen hypoxia. It was the first execution in the world to use this particular method. [2] Smith was convicted of the March 18, 1988, murder-for-hire of Elizabeth Sennett in Colbert County, Alabama.
